I recently had a sore throat starting up and I went to Wal Mart looking for Zinc lozenges, well I did not find them but I found these sootherbs! I saw a few others but they were called '' homeopathic '' ( which I steer clear of )
I bought these Sootherbs which are lozenges that are sort of grainy, I thought I would not like the taste and feel of them in my mouth, but they are actually good. I bought the cherry flavor Sootherbs have... Vitamin C 100 mg of ( which is really not that much) Zinc 10 mg Echinaccea 25 mg Wild Cherry bark extract 25 mg Citrus bioflavonoids 25 mg You are supposed to take 1 every 3-4 hours. Let it dissolve in your mouth. I also took with it...Emer'gen- C which is powdered Vit C you put in 6 oz of cold water and dissolve it and drink. I take this every 2 to three hours until I feel like it has worked usually I do not have to take it more than a day. It really kicks out sickness. We give this to everyone in our family even the little ones. It is good to keep both of these products in your purse for ready use in the cold months!
